logo

Output 68996d3242873561241321fda56bd227b3193abf8a87d3bcaf6523ef4b5138ba:1

value
16546683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0a430175b32c3cfe8ce54e841eee4c495a99923 OP_EQUAL
address
3Ho1YH5zvhwmjaqX7xidSWfHBbF2WSzz7Q
transaction
68996d3242873561241321fda56bd227b3193abf8a87d3bcaf6523ef4b5138ba